Getting a whiff is a colloquial expression that means to catch a brief scent of something. There are many synonyms for this phrase depending on context and the strength of the smell. For example, a faint scent could be referred to as a hint or a trace. A stronger smell may be called an aroma, fragrance or odor. Other synonyms for getting a whiff include sniffing, inhaling, catching a scent, picking up a smell or detecting an odor. Regardless of the words used, each synonym helps to convey the sense of taking in a fleeting scent.
